Good, Bad, and Ugly

I lived in Maple Grove for 12 months during 2001/2002.

I?ll begin with the good things about Maple Grove:
  • The complex is in a newer, quiet neighborhood. The low levels of traffic mean it?s a pretty nice area for walking or biking.
  • Most of the buildings in the complex are pretty small, and therefore not very dense. This helps keep it quiet and makes it a more attractive complex than many others
  • They allow cats and small dogs. It?s hard to find a nice place close to Madison that allows dogs, in my experience.
  • The complex has a pool, hot tub, and workout facility, all of which are of reasonable quality. The workout facility, in particular, is one of the better aparment exercise facilities I?ve seen in Madison.
  • The complex is mostly pretty new, and the building and apartments generally look pretty nice because of it.
  • There is a decent grocery store conveniently located about a block away. There are also a few takeout restaurants, a good video rental place, and a gas station.

    Next, the bad/ugly things that prompted us to move out:
  • The apartments are really not convenient if you need to go into the city every day. In fact, we didn?t even need to get all the way into the city, just to the University. It can easily take 25 minutes to drive in in the morning. I don?t consider that to be convenient.
  • Another down side is noise. There seems to be no noise insulation in the buildings, so you always hear your neighbors walking around, etc.
  • The maintenance here is very, very poor. It usually takes them several trips, and they usually still don?t fix it. We had three issues we called them about, and often we called them more than once. They addressed all three at various times, but all three were still problems months later when we moved out. The rain gutter on our building was broken off and hanging on for dear life for the duration of our stay. The only common areas that are ever cleaned are those in the main building (where the office is). I don?t recall our hallway ever being cleaned, and the garage and especially the dumpster area were filthy the entire year we lived there. And while I?m on the garage topic, the garage door in our building was broken constantly. Kind of hard to get to work in the morning when you can get your car out of the garage! (And no, I?m not lazy -- I did try to open it myself. But the door would literally break its guide rails and wedge itself in a manner that would usually prevent you from manually opening it.)
  • While I rated the parking as 'adequate', that's really only if you have the underground parking. For some reason the outdoor parking always seemed to fill up. In fact, usually to the point where a lot of people were parking on the grass. I'm not sure why this happened, since there appears to be a lot of surface parking and most of the buildings also have underground parking. It was often tough for our visitors to find a place to park.
  • Maple Grove also makes you sign a form saying you?ll have the carpets professionally cleaned when you move out, which is just wrong.
